Individuals have always wanted to take music with them, have they not? The transistor radios of the Fifties and Sixties gave way to portable cassette players so that Individuals could take their own recordings with them. Then you had high quality ghetto blasters with tape decks and personalized stereos like the Walkman. Then the CD Walkman and ghetto blasters with CD players.
The stress has always been on making it possible for Individuals to take their music with them. One of the most recent in this long line of units for music on the go is the Apple iPhone, which permits you to take thousands of songs or tracks with you without a single cassette or CD in sight. Like many devices of its kind, the Apple iPhone records onto its own memory.
This makes it light and highly portable. The music is kept in recordable internal memory chips in MP3 format. This technology has killed off portable tape and CD players very quickly. You can now take all of your music and the music of all your family with you wherever you go without the need of a car. It will all fit in your pocket in one device.
The Apple iPhone is unusual in that it is a cell phone that will do all this. The iPhone combines an MP3 player into a mobile phone along with a number of other neat features such as video and video telephony and a personal organizer. Not just that but the iPhone is easy to use even for the non-technically minded.
You can readily browse your collection of music on the large screen at the touch of a few buttons and you can organize or reorganize the music in to a list by album name, artist, song or date entered. If you have missed a song or an album, you can dial into Apple's on line music store and download it into your library there and then.
Furthermore, if you forget the album that your song is on, you can download the album covers for your tracks using Cover Flow in order to make them more identifiable.
